Output 628bdee584084ce9fa33f3d8d9f3f41fa8031f2d8486863af62c263d96dbf1a2:1

value
394020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1fb219812110e7e280cc88e8651b5e2b9b731af OP_EQUAL
address
3NHtocHMZfQH1DAXZJZpuEkS5BU3vvLLmu
transaction
628bdee584084ce9fa33f3d8d9f3f41fa8031f2d8486863af62c263d96dbf1a2
confirmations
281313
spent
true